方法签名
public double calculateAnswer(double wingSpan, int numberOfEngines,double length, double grossTons) {//do the calculation here}The signature of the method declared above is://上面方法的签名为calculateAnswer(double, int, double, double)
在 Java 中获取对象的内存地址(十进制)
String s = "123";System.out.println(System.identityHashCode(s)); // 460141958
多态
在 Java 程序设计语言中,对象变量是多态的。
e.getSalary(),当 e 引用 Employee 对象时,将调用 Employee 类中的方法。
e.getSalary(),当 e 引用 Manager 对象时,将调用 Manager 类中的方法。
上述过程称为多态,一个对象变量可以指示多种按实际类型的现象。自动选择那个方法的现象称为动态绑定。
获取 classpath 类路径地址:
System.out.println(Class.class.getResource("/"));
